IoT + Big Data

CitySense Urban Intelligence

A municipal IoT platform collecting and analyzing data from 10,000+ city sensors.

Metro City Government
June 2024
12 months
CitySense Urban Intelligence - Image 1

Project Overview

This smart city solution aggregates real-time data from traffic sensors, air quality monitors, waste management systems, and energy grids. The platform provides predictive analytics for urban planning, automated alerts for infrastructure issues, and public dashboards. Machine learning models predict traffic patterns, optimize waste collection routes, and identify maintenance needs before failures occur.

Challenges

  • Processing 50,000+ sensor events per second with <100ms latency
  • Maintaining data accuracy during sensor calibration drift
  • Securing field devices against physical tampering in public spaces
  • Visualizing city-wide data without overloading municipal networks

Solutions

  • Implemented edge computing nodes with Apache Kafka Streams for real-time processing
  • Developed auto-calibration algorithms using neighboring sensor consensus
  • Deployed hardware security modules (HSMs) with tamper-evident enclosures
  • Built vector tile-based visualization engine with dynamic LOD rendering

Technologies Used

Apache Kafka logo
Apache Kafka
Node-RED logo
Node-RED
TimescaleDB logo
TimescaleDB
React logo
React
Python logo
Python
"CitySense gave us unprecedented visibility into urban operations and the tools to make data-driven decisions that improved quality of life."
Mayor Olivia Martinez
Mayor Olivia Martinez
City of Metro

Project Details

Client

Metro City Government

Duration

12 months

Team Size

14 engineers/data specialists

Budget

$2.8 million

Completion

June 2024

Key Features

Real-time Sensor Monitoring
Predictive Maintenance
Traffic Optimization
Environmental Analytics
Public Dashboards
Incident Automation
Historical Trend Analysis

Achievements

20% reduction in traffic congestion
15% energy savings for city facilities
Faster emergency response times
75% citizen approval rating

Ready to Start Your Own Project?

Let's create something amazing together. Contact us to discuss how we can bring your vision to life with the same level of excellence and dedication.